What is Lens Shape Stability at Extreme Temperatures?

Lens shape stability refers to the ability of an optical component to maintain its original shape and dimensions under various temperature conditions. As temperatures fluctuate, lenses can expand or contract, affecting their focal length and optical performance. This phenomenon can be particularly pronounced in extreme environments, where temperatures may range from -20C to 120C (-4F to 248F) or more.

In industries such as aerospace, defense, and medical devices, optical components are exposed to harsh environmental conditions, including high temperatures, humidity, and vibrations. As a result, lens shape stability is crucial for ensuring optimal performance and maintaining the integrity of these systems.
